Día!: Books To Celebrate Every Child

By Angela Martinez, Children's Associate, Broken Arrow Library

Every year on April 30th (and for Tulsa City-County Library, all of April), libraries celebrate El día de los niños/El día de los libros (Día!), a day that honors children, families, and reading. But Día! is more than just a single celebration. It’s a reminder that connecting kids to books, language, and culture should happen all year long. 

In my Build A Reader storytimes, I see this play out in real time. Many of the children who attend my programs come from similar backgrounds, and there is so much value in introducing them to stories that act as “windows” into lives that look different from their own. But there is something truly special when a new child walks in and, through a book I’ve chosen, gets to experience a “mirror” moment—seeing themselves, their family, or their culture reflected on the page.

That’s what Día! is all about. It encourages us to celebrate all children while also honoring the languages, traditions, and experiences they bring with them. Picture books are such a natural way to do this. Whether it’s a bilingual story, a folktale, or a book featuring characters from different cultural backgrounds, these stories help children feel seen while also building understanding and empathy.

Día is a mindset when planning storytime. It’s about being intentional with book selection, thinking about who might walk through the door, and making sure every child has the chance to feel like they belong. Because when kids see themselves in books, it doesn’t just support literacy—it builds confidence, connection, and a love of reading that can last a lifetime.
